Rettendon Common - Application for a Premises Licence
What is proposed?
LICENSING ACT 2003 - PUBLIC NOTICE OF APPLICATION FOR A PREMISES LICENCE CERTIFICATE (under Sections 17 of the Act)
Application has been made for a premises licence to authorise the sale of alcohol within the onsite cafe, Bay and Grey. Beechwood Equestrian Centre Main Road, Rettendon Common, Chelmsford, Essex CM3 8EA. For consumption on the premises, 9.30am-10pm Monday to Sunday
Any representations by a Responsible Authority or any persons must be made in writing to Chelmsford Council Licensing or by email to licensing@chelmsford.gov.uk by 18th December 2025
Representations received after this date cannot be considered.
It is an offence knowingly or recklessly to make a false statement in connection with an application punishable on summary conviction by a fine.
The full application can be arranged for viewing with the licensing department upon request.
